Royal Challengers BengaluruLucknow Super Giants will face Royal Challengers Bengaluru in the 50th match of IPL 2026 at Ekana Cricket Stadium, Lucknow. This match will come at a crucial stage of the league. RCB enter this game with a strong record.
They sit 2nd on the table with 6 wins and 3 losses, and a net run rate of 1.420, which shows consistency. LSG are struggling at 10th place with 2 wins and 7 losses and a NRR of -1.076.
LSG have lost their last 5 games. Their form remains a major concern. RCB also come after a loss, but their overall performance has been stable. In the head-to-head record, RCB leads 3-2 in the last 5 matches. Teams chasing have won 3 of those games. This trend will again play a key role in this contest.

Royal Challengers BengaluruLSG have adjusted their batting order a few times. Mitchell Marsh and Josh Inglis opened the innings in the last match. Aiden Markram moved down the order to fit Rishabh Pant at the top earlier and later for Badoni & Inglis.
Marsh scored 44 off 25 while Nicholas Pooran returned to form with 63 off 21. Himmat Singh added 40 off 31 at number seven as LSG posted 228/5 but failed to defend it.
Marsh and Markram have 256 and 224 runs this season. Pant has 204 and struggled for consistency. In bowling, Prince Yadav leads with 13 wickets in 9 matches, but went wicketless in the last two games. Mohsin Khan picked up 10 wickets in 5 games. Mohammed Shami has 8 in 9 matches. M Siddharth claimed 6 in 4, while Digvesh Rathi just 3.
Marsh, Markram and Prince are the key players.

Jacob Bethell opened with Virat Kohli in the last two games instead of Philip Salt. Kohli has 379 runs at a strike rate of 165.50 with 3 fifties. Devdutt Padikkal has 282 runs, with 3 fifties, at number 3. Salt also has 2 fifties this season.
Rajat Patidar handled the middle order with Tim David, Jitesh Sharma and Romario Shepherd. Patidar scored 257 runs at a strike rate of 200.78. David contributed 192 runs at a strike rate of 192.00.
In bowling, Bhuvneshwar Kumar leads the attack with Josh Hazlewood and Krunal Pandya. Kumar picked 3 wickets in each of the last 3 matches and led with 17 wickets at an economy of 7.54. Pandya took 9 wickets in 9 games, while Hazlewood has 8 wickets in 6 matches. Rasikh Salam and Suyash Sharma picked 6 and 7 wickets.
Kohli, Patidar and Bhuvneshwar are the key players.
